对不起我的英语,我来自俄罗斯。我正在编写一些代码(在数据库中添加有关我的客户的信息,选择此信息,将其显示在我网站的某些页面上,并添加功能 EDIT 以获取有关客户的信息)。
在包含有关客户的完整信息的页面上,我显示了“编辑”有关这些客户的信息的链接。
它可以工作,好吧,但是当我在链接周围包装模板代码以进行编辑时:
{% if user.is_authentificated %}
<a href.....>edit</a>
{% endif %}
链接未显示,但我已获得授权!(进入管理面板不需要授权)
请告诉我我做错了什么?
如果你想对任何用户进行身份验证,Django 提供了一个内置方法。您可以尝试如下代码:
{% if user.is_authenticated %}
<a href.....>edit</a>
{% endif %}
I hope it will work.
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句